Improved docs, formatting and handling of globals
This commit is contained in:
parent
93872f2597
commit
ff8bc8cce6
2 changed files with 9 additions and 9 deletions
|
|
@ -1,8 +1,8 @@
|
||||||
#' @title computeIndLogml
|
#' @title computeIndLogml
|
||||||
#' @description Palauttaa yksilön logml:n, kun oletetaan yksilön alkuperät
|
#' @description Palauttaa yksilön logml:n, kun oletetaan yksilön alkuperät
|
||||||
#' määritellyiksi kuten osuusTaulu:ssa.
|
#' määritellyiksi kuten osuusTaulu:ssa.
|
||||||
#' @param omaFreqs omaFreqs
|
#' @param omaFreqs own Freqs?
|
||||||
#' @param osuusTaulu osuusTaulu
|
#' @param osuusTaulu Percentage table?
|
||||||
#' @export
|
#' @export
|
||||||
computeIndLogml <- function (omaFreqs, osuusTaulu) {
|
computeIndLogml <- function (omaFreqs, osuusTaulu) {
|
||||||
|
|
||||||
|
|
@ -14,7 +14,7 @@ computeIndLogml <- function (omaFreqs, osuusTaulu) {
|
||||||
apu <- sum(apu)
|
apu <- sum(apu)
|
||||||
}
|
}
|
||||||
|
|
||||||
apu = log(apu)
|
apu <- log(apu)
|
||||||
|
|
||||||
loggis <- sum(apu)
|
loggis <- sum(apu)
|
||||||
return (loggis)
|
return (loggis)
|
||||||
|
|
|
||||||
|
|
@ -3,15 +3,15 @@
|
||||||
#' muutos logml:ss? mikäli populaatiosta i siirretään osuuden verran
|
#' muutos logml:ss? mikäli populaatiosta i siirretään osuuden verran
|
||||||
#' todennäköisyysmassaa populaatioon j. Mikäli populaatiossa i ei ole mitään
|
#' todennäköisyysmassaa populaatioon j. Mikäli populaatiossa i ei ole mitään
|
||||||
#' siirrettävää, on vastaavassa kohdassa rivi nollia.
|
#' siirrettävää, on vastaavassa kohdassa rivi nollia.
|
||||||
#' @param osuus osuus
|
#' @param osuus Percentages?
|
||||||
#' @param osuusTaulu osuusTaulu
|
#' @param omaFreqs own Freqs?
|
||||||
#' @param omaFreqs omaFreqs
|
#' @param osuusTaulu Percentage table?
|
||||||
#' @param logml logml
|
#' @param logml log maximum likelihood
|
||||||
#' @param COUNTS COUNTS
|
#' @param COUNTS COUNTS
|
||||||
#'
|
#' @export
|
||||||
laskeMuutokset4 <- function (osuus, osuusTaulu, omaFreqs, logml,
|
laskeMuutokset4 <- function (osuus, osuusTaulu, omaFreqs, logml,
|
||||||
COUNTS = matrix(0)) {
|
COUNTS = matrix(0)) {
|
||||||
npops <- dim(COUNTS)[3]
|
npops <- ifelse(is.na(dim(COUNTS)[3]), 1, dim(COUNTS)[3])
|
||||||
notEmpty <- osuusTaulu > 0.005
|
notEmpty <- osuusTaulu > 0.005
|
||||||
muutokset <- zeros(npops)
|
muutokset <- zeros(npops)
|
||||||
empties <- !notEmpty
|
empties <- !notEmpty
|
||||||
|
|
|
||||||
Loading…
Add table
Reference in a new issue